Witryna17 maj 2012 · While agriculture’s share in India’s economy has progressively declined to less than 15% due to the high growth rates of the industrial and services sectors, the sector’s importance in India’s economic and social fabric goes well beyond this indicator. First, nearly three-quarters of India’s families depend on rural incomes. Witryna27 lip 2024 · iv) Plantation Farming: In this type, a single cash crop is grown for sale in national and international markets. This type of agriculture involves the growing and processing of a single cash crop purely meant for sale. Tea, coffee, rubber, banana, and spices are all examples of plantation crops.
